Overview of correspondent residential mortgage lending

Correspondent residential mortgage lenders represent an essential component of the home financing ecosystem. These lenders act as intermediaries between borrowers and larger lending institutions, allowing them to provide mortgage products without needing to be a full-fledged lender themselves. They handle the loan application process, underwriting, and often even the closing of the loan while selling it off to a bigger lender afterward. This model allows correspondent lenders to offer competitive rates and services while maintaining a personalized touch.

The significance of correspondent lenders in the mortgage industry cannot be underestimated. They provide flexibility, particularly for those who may not fit the traditional lending profile, allowing for customized financing solutions. By leveraging existing relationships with various funding partners, correspondent lenders can offer a wider array of mortgage options to suited borrowers. Moreover, for many homebuyers, working with a correspondent lender results in faster processing times, a superior level of customer service, and potentially lowering fees associated with obtaining a mortgage.

Ensuring compliance and legal considerations

Compliance with regulations is of paramount importance in the mortgage lending process. Correspondent lenders must adhere to both federal and state laws that govern lending practices. This includes understanding regulations such as the Truth in Lending Act and the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act. Ensuring compliance not only protects the lender but also safeguards the borrower’s rights.

Disclosures included in the correspondent residential mortgage lenders form play a crucial role in informing borrowers about their rights and responsibilities. Key disclosures explain the terms of the mortgage, any fees associated with the loan, and how interest will accrue. Adhering to state-specific regulations is also essential, as differences from one state to another can significantly impact application processes and required documentation.
